Tianjin University to Establish Intelligent Medical Engineering Center

 Campus

On October 31, the Ministry of Education officially announced the 2019 list of projects for the Engineering Research Centers. Tianjin University received approval to establish the Intelligent Medical Engineering Center of the Ministry of Education. This facility is expected to become a world leading platform for technological innovation in intelligent medical engineering, which will greatly contribute to medical development in China.

The Intelligent Medical Engineering Center will rely on the Medical College of Tianjin University, and fully integrate the resources of its cooperative enterprises such as 6 affiliated Tianjin University hospitals and the China Electronics Corporation (CEC). Facing the “Healthy China 2030” strategic demand, the center pursues intelligent human-computer interaction as its main job on the basis of modern medicine and biological theories. Centering on brain cognition, big data, cloud computing, machine learning and other aspects of artificial intelligence as well as the urgent demand of clinical application, the center focuses on key and generic technology and development of new intelligent products. In the future, the concern will focus on interdisciplinary integration and realize intelligent diagnosis and treatment based on human-computer coordination as well as safe and efficient clinical applications to provide product and technology support for the national economy, public health and special needs.

In 2019, universities and colleges have established 61 nationwide engineering research centers on behalf of the Ministry of Education.
